Lotide

A mini clone of the Lodash library.

Purpose

BEWARE: This library was published for learning purposes. It is not intended for use in production-grade software.

This project was created and published by me as part of my learnings at Lighthouse Labs.

Usage

Install it:

npm install @saeonny/lotide

Require it:

const _ = require('@saeonny/lotide');

Call it:

const results = _.tail([1, 2, 3]) // => [2, 3]

Documentation

The following functions are currently implemented:

  • head(array): returns the first item in the array. If the array is empty then retun undefined.
  • tail(array): returns the "tail" of an array: everything except for the first item (head) of the provided array.
  • middle(array): return middle item(s) as array of given array.
  • without(array, remove): return a subset of a given array, removing unwanted elements.
  • countOnly(allItems, itemsToCount): will be given an array and an object. It will return an object containing counts of everything that the input object listed.
  • countLetters(string): return a count of each of the letters in given string.
  • letterPositions(sentence): return all the indices (zero-based positions) in the string where each character is found.
  • findKeyByValue(object, value): return a key on an object where its value matches a given value.
  • map(array, callback): return a new array based on the results of the callback function.
  • takeUntil(array, callback): return a "slice of the array with elements taken from the beginning." It should keep going until the callback/predicate returns a truthy value.
  • findKey(object, callback): return the first key for which the callback returns a truthy value.
